Caramelized Onion & Goat Cheese Bites

Ingredients
  • 2 tbsp. ext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1 tbsp. unsalted butter
  • 4 medium yellow onions, thinly sliced
  • Kosher salt
  • Freshly ground black pepper
  • 1 tbsp. balsamic vinegar
  • 1 tbsp. fresh thyme leaves, plus more for serving
  • All-purpose flour, for surface
  • 2 sheets frozen puff pastry (from a 17.3-oz. package), thawed in refrigerator
  • 1 large egg, beaten to blend
  • 4 oz. goat cheese, crumbled
  • 2 tsp. honey
Instructions
  1. In a large skillet over medium heat, heat oil and butter. Add onions, 2 teaspoons salt, and ¼ teaspoon pepper and cook, stirring occasionally, until very onions are very caramelized, about 35 minutes. Stir in vinegar and thyme. Let cool to room temperature.
  2. Arrange racks in upper and lower thirds of oven; preheat to 375°.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ment.
  3. On a lightly floured surface, cut each puff pastry sheet into 9 (3"-by-3") squares. Transfer squares to prepared sheets. Top each with about 1 tablespoon onions, leaving a ½" border on all sides. Brush exposed edges with egg. Divide goat cheese among squares.
  4. Bake tarts, rotating sheets front to back halfway through, until puffed and golden brown, 25 to 28 minutes. Drizzle a little honey on each tart. Top with more thyme and pepper. Serve immediately or at room temperature.
